I did post on the Vendors site and I got a lot of feedback which is great.. now ALL I need to do to finalize the limo part would be to figure a hotel where the family will be staying... they're asking for like 200 a night.. and of course my parents want to pay for like all of our family that will be staying for two nights..




I'm looking up hotels too....the lowest quote i've gotten so far is $149/night at the holiday inn in suffolk.....I hear it's not gorgeous, but they don't require a minimum # of nights, or a min # of rooms booked....and if 10+ rooms are booked, they offer shuttle service to the RH.

I spoke with the Hilton in Melville and they require a min # of booked rooms.....say we block 10, and they require 7 are booked, but only 5 guests book rooms....we'd be responsible for the other 2....i'm not having that.

I think we're going to block 2 hotels (the holiday inn and a nicer one) and let the guests have their choice. We're also selecting a hotel that has a bar and telling our friends by word of mouth about it.....that's where we'll be staying the night of so it'll be a nicer place, and we hope to continue the party there.
